Output 26f38cd13cd9da1743d10665d39b7304d4ecbda2e410daa2a67d28201d298c38:0

value
2907696
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1716585f6e8d39a1d19dc62fc6ac6d7efc134e9b OP_EQUALVERIFY OP_CHECKSIG
address
1375Jz5zdhEv5PF93AX89T7hKgM4b56C6s
transaction
26f38cd13cd9da1743d10665d39b7304d4ecbda2e410daa2a67d28201d298c38
spent
true